What is the most complex attribute to understand in a v security camera 150ft cable, and why is it important?
The most complex attribute is signal integrity and power delivery over the coax run. RG59 coax carries video as a high-frequency signal, and length, impedance (typically 75 ohms), shielding, and cable capacitance all affect image quality. The run also has to carry DC power to the camera without significant voltage drop, so using a dedicated CCTV power cable or a combined RG59 with power kit helps maintain reliable operation on a 150ft distance. In practice, choose shielded RG59+POWER options from established brands to balance distance, weather exposure, and EMI considerations.

What maintenance and compatibility steps help ensure a v security camera 150ft cable stays reliable over time?
Keep connections clean and dry, mount cables with gentle bends to avoid kinks, and use weatherproof, rubber-insulated cables for outdoor runs. Verify compatibility with your DVR/NVR and whether you need a separate power supply or a combined RG59 + power setup.
